[linter-miner] linter: add sprintfbool — flag fmt.Sprintf("%t", b) → strconv.FormatBool(b)#46898
Conversation
Reports fmt.Sprintf("%t", b) calls where b is a single bool value and
suggests using strconv.FormatBool(b) instead. This is a natural
complement to the existing sprintfint linter (which flags Sprintf("%d",n)
→ strconv.Itoa).
The linter:
- Matches only the exact predeclared bool type (not named bool aliases)
- Provides a SuggestedFix that rewrites the call and manages imports
- Skips generated files and respects //nolint:sprintfbool directives

There was a problem hiding this comment.
REQUEST_CHANGES — two correctness bugs in the suggested-fix path must be addressed before merging.
Blocking issues
1. orphanFmt count is wrong for files with multiple flagged calls (HIGH)
Line 195: countPkgUsesInFile returns the total number of fmt uses in the file. When a file has 2+ fmt.Sprintf("%t", b) calls and nothing else that uses fmt, orphanFmt is false for every diagnostic. After all fixes are applied, the fmt import is orphaned and the fixed file does not compile. The test fixture only exercises the single-call case, so this is untested.
2. addStrconvRemoveFmtEdits emits edits in reverse-position order (MEDIUM)
Line 267–279: the strconv insertion (at fmtDecl.Rparen, higher offset) is emitted before the fmt-line deletion (at lineStart, lower offset). analysistest sorts before applying (so tests pass), but gopls and golangci-lint consume edits in slice order, corrupting the import block when both edits are applied.

There was a problem hiding this comment.
addStrconvRemoveFmtEdits returns TextEdits in reverse-position order, which can corrupt source when tools apply edits sequentially without sorting.
💡 Explanation and fix
The returned slice is:
[]analysis.TextEdit{
{Pos: fmtDecl.Rparen, ...}, // INSERT strconv — higher offset
{Pos: lineStart, End: lineEnd, NewText: nil}, // DELETE fmt line — lower offset
}The Go analysis framework's analysistest sorts edits before applying them (so tests pass), but gopls and golangci-lint's autofixer apply edits in slice order. Applying the higher-offset insertion first shifts byte offsets, so the subsequent delete targets a now-wrong range, corrupting the import block.
Fix: reverse the slice order so the lower-position deletion comes first:
return []analysis.TextEdit{
{Pos: lineStart, End: lineEnd, NewText: nil}, // delete fmt line first
{Pos: fmtDecl.Rparen, End: fmtDecl.Rparen,
NewText: []byte("\t\"strconv\"\n")}, // then insert strconv
}

Summary
Adds a new
sprintfboolGo static analysis linter that flagsfmt.Sprintf("%t", b)calls wherebis the exact predeclaredbooltype and suggests rewriting tostrconv.FormatBool(b). The suggested fix automatically managesfmt/strconvimport additions and removals.Changes
New:
pkg/linters/sprintfbool/sprintfbool.go— Analysis pass (~450 lines): matchesfmt.Sprintf("%t", b)with exact predeclared bool type; excludes named bool types, multi-arg calls, non-%tverbs; skips generated files; honours//nolint:sprintfbool; generates import-aware SuggestedFix edits (add strconv, remove fmt if unused, swap sole import, preserve aliases).sprintfbool_test.go— Test harness usinganalysistest.RunWithSuggestedFixes.testdata/src/sprintfbool/— 9 fixture pairs: basic variable/literal, named bool (no diagnostic), multiple calls (single import edit), single fmt use (swap import), mixed use (keep fmt), aliased import, raw backtick imports, shadowed identifier (no fix), comment overlap (no fix).Modified:
cmd/linters/main.goAdds
sprintfboolimport and registerssprintfbool.Analyzeralongside existing passes.New:
docs/adr/46898-add-sprintfbool-linter.mdDraft ADR documenting the decision, alternatives considered (extend sprintfint; use external linter), and consequences.
